| Sad Bastard A Better Bastard | If you look at the eras and plunked Moss into Rice's era Moss would have dominated if he had Brady throwing him the ball in that Era. Back then Defenses were able to do much more to impede receivers etc. Moss is bigger, fatser, jumpes better, and is stronger than Rice with the same(ish) hands IMHO. Rice isn't close to as fast as Moss, and therefore would not be as good at getting open as Moss. Moss' headspace is what has kept him down for so long in his career. he started off well at Minny, but let his ego get the best of him. what made Rice so good was his route running and Bill Walsh's amazing pioneering of Westcoast offense when the NFL Defense was crushing most Offensive coordinators. Also he was healthy for almost his whole career without major injury. also keep in mind that Rice had arguably the best QB's of his time in Young and Montana as well as other weapons like Roger Craig and such. I don't think that the Pats have any other truly hall of fame worthy weapons in their lineup on offense...Stallworth and welker are good, but not great, Brady is what makes them good, not the player themself. In todays era Brady and Moss > Rice and Joe/Young Yesteryear ear Brady Moss > Joe/Young & Rice my $0.02 |

Especially when it comes to hands. As for stats, they actually are close. Rice's numbers for first 10 seasons: 820 Rec, 13275 yards and 131 TD. Moss's: 774 Rec, 12193 yards and 124 TD. He did this in an era where you said the DB's could do much more to impede the WR's (which is true) and that makes the numbers even better. You can't put Moss in another era because players these days are all bigger, faster stronger. That's like saying Shaq is better than Wilt because he would dominate in Wilt's era. You look at what Rice did in terms of accolades, awards, and records and he's light years ahead of Moss. | |
